Continuous Integration (CI) is a development practice where developers integrate code into a shared repository frequently preferably several times a day. UX design focuses on building systems that demonstrate a deep understanding of end users. An Epic is a container for a significant Solution development initiative that captures the more substantial investments that occur within a portfolio.
